Mortgage note investing has emerged as a fascinating avenue for savvy investors seeking to accumulate consistent returns. By acquiring mortgage notes, or the debt obligations tied to real estate loans, investors can capitalize from regular interest payments and the potential for escalation in note value over time. The appeal of this strategy lies in its relative stability, as it often involves established loans with verifiable track records.
- Investors can expand their portfolios by adding mortgage notes, providing a complementary asset class to traditional investments like stocks and bonds.
- The availability of mortgage notes can vary depending on the specific agreements of the note and market activity.
- Note investing can be a indirect investment strategy, where investors receive regular interest payments without actively controlling the underlying property.
Before diving into mortgage note investing, it's crucial to perform thorough due diligence to evaluate the risk associated with each investment opportunity.

Thorough Mortgage Note Due Diligence: Safeguarding Your Returns
When investing in mortgage notes, it's crucial to conduct rigorous due diligence to mitigate risk and preserve your investment. This procedure requires a detailed examination of the note's conditions, the borrower's financial history, and the underlying collateral. By identifying any existing concerns early on, you can arrive at more informed investment decisions.
- Utilize a qualified professional in mortgage note analysis to support your due diligence efforts.
- Scrutinize the note's features, including interest rates, payment terms, and any clauses that could affect your returns.
- Confirm the borrower's financial history through a thorough credit check.
Gaining the full scope of a mortgage note before pursuing it is paramount to safeguarding your capital and achieving your financial goals.
